A study of photo-oxidized poly(acrylic acid) luminescence.
- 93 p.
Source: Masters Abstracts International, Volume: 47-04, page: 2203.
Thesis (M.Sc.)--University of Toronto (Canada), 2008.
When irradiated with ultraviolet light at 254 mn, poly(acrylic acid) (PAA) became luminescent. It is thought that this luminescence comes from main chain carbonyl groups that appear during photo-oxidation [94]. Three molecular weights of PAA were irradiated: 2,000 M¯w (2K), 100,000 M¯w (100K), and 1,000,000 M¯w (1Mil). 2K PAA showed peak fluorescence at 410 nm, while 100K and 1Mil PAA both showed peaks at 435 nm and 495 nm. UV-Visible spectroscopy showed 3 transitions increase in intensity during irradiation. The transition at 275 nm was assigned as the n → pi* of main chain carbonyl groups. The fluorescence seen was not attributable to this transition because the peaks in the excitation spectrum are lower energy. Fluorescence lifetimes were measured as 2.7 ns, 4.6 ns and 4.9 ns, respectively; using time correlated single photon counting. The photo-oxidized polymer deposited in multilayer films when deposition pH was 4, verified by atomic force microscopy.
